I thank the Minister of State for his reply. I am glad Ros a' Mhíl is still on the agenda, but the economic case has to be proven. A great deal of documentation has been sent to the Minister on that. I will talk to local people who are on the committee to put the material back on the Minister's desk. Will the Minister of State indicate to the Minister, Deputy Coveney, that the potential to open up the land bank around Ros a' Mhíl and create a ripple effect for jobs on the west coast is completely dependent on the development of the deep water berth? It is essential that the Minister places the matter higher up the list of priorities as it is not just about the pier itself or a storm damage scenario but also an investment in the future that will create jobs and employment. The multiplier effect for the west in general would be very great.
